Do I need a visa to enter Jordan?
Yes, most travelers are required to apply for a visa. You can apply for an eVisa online before traveling or obtain a visa on arrival at Queen Alia International Airport and select land borders. Some nationalities are exempt; always check eligibility in advance.

Can I enter Jordan through the land borders with Israel or Saudi Arabia?
Yes, you can enter Jordan via land borders from both Israel and Saudi Arabia, but entry requirements and border availability vary.
Sheikh Hussein (north) and Wadi Araba/Aqaba (south) issue visas on arrival.
Allenby/King Hussein Bridge (from Israel/West Bank) does not issue visas on arrival; you must have a visa in advance.

Is a yellow fever vaccination certificate required for Jordan?
No, unless you are arriving from or transiting through a yellow fever–endemic country. Other vaccinations such as hepatitis A and typhoid are recommended for health safety but are not mandatory.

Will I need to show proof of accommodation when entering Jordan?
Yes, you will likely need to show proof of accommodation, such as a hotel reservation or other details of your stay, when entering Jordan. This is a common requirement, along with a valid passport, proof of financial means, and a return or onward ticket, to demonstrate you have sufficient support and a plan for your visit.

Can I extend my visa while in Jordan?
Yes, you can extend your visa while in Jordan by registering and applying for an extension at a local Jordanian police station before your current visa expires. You'll need to gather the required documents and visit a police station, ideally in a larger city like Amman, to complete the process. If you overstay your visa, you will incur a fine, so it's essential to handle the extension in advance.
